Crime & Punishment: Law & Order

Rate this book
Traces the history of crime and punishment from 3200 B.C. to the present and discusses how and why the laws which govern people's behavior were created

About the author

Fiona Macdonald

633 books45 followers
Fiona Macdonald studied history at Cambridge University and at the University of East Anglia. She has taught in schools, adult education and university, and is the author of numerous books for children on historical topics.
